The Site Shed is a global podcast for tradies and trade-based business owners, designed to educate and inform around the topics that matter most in running a business.

Hosted by former plumber and digital agency owner Matt Jones, the podcast covers real-world conversations on apprenticeships, marketing, systems, technology, hiring, leadership, and more — all tailored to the trades.

What exactly is the $20k instant-asset write-off? | ft. David Rosenthal | Ep.424
Q: What assets are available for this write-off?
It applies to a wide range of assets including machinery, tools, vehicles, provided they are under $20,000.
What exactly is the $20k instant-asset write-off? | ft. David Rosenthal | Ep.424
Q: Is this relevant to the business or the individual?
This is relevant to businesses; it must be businesses, sole traders, or companies, not individuals.
What exactly is the $20k instant-asset write-off? | ft. David Rosenthal | Ep.424
Q: What are some of the common misconceptions around this initiative?
Most common misconceptions are that people think it's the first $20,000 of an asset, and they don't understand that write-off means you don't get that money back.
